Let’s start with the honest maths, because that’s where most casino reviews go quiet. If you deposit £50 and an operator hands you £50 in bonus funds at a 35x wagering requirement, you must wager £1,750 before a penny of that bonus becomes withdrawable. The house edge on most slots sits between 2% and 5%, so the expected cost of clearing that wagering is somewhere in the region of £35 to £87. Suddenly the headline “100% match” looks less like a gift and more like a contract with fine print.
That’s not to say bonuses are worthless. It’s to say the real value of an independent casino lives elsewhere: in payout speed, in game variety that isn’t just the same fifty slots repackaged, in support that actually answers, and in terms you can understand without a law degree. The Terms That Actually Decide Your Value
Headline bonus figures are marketing. The terms beneath them are the real contract, and they vary wildly between operators. Wagering requirements are commercial terms set by each site, and while they commonly range from about 20x to 65x, the spread matters enormously to your expected return.
Consider two operators offering the same £100 bonus. One applies a 20x wagering requirement, giving you £2,000 of turnover to clear. The other applies 65x, demanding £6,500. On a typical slot with a 4% house edge, the expected cost of clearing the first is £80, while the second costs £260. The bonus that looked identical on paper has a threefold difference in real value.

Game weighting is the second term to scrutinise. A “all games contribute 100%” claim is rare; most operators weight slots at 100% but drop table games to 10% or even less. If you prefer blackjack or roulette, a bonus with heavy table-game weighting penalties is effectively worthless to you. Check the contribution rates before you accept any offer.
Then there’s the matter of maximum bet limits while wagering. Many operators cap your stake at £5 per spin during bonus play, which is sensible for them and survivable for you. A few go lower, and a few don’t impose a cap at all — but those are increasingly rare. Read the full terms, not the summary bullet points.

Can I trust an independent casino with my money?
Yes, provided the operator holds a valid UK Gambling Commission licence — that’s the non-negotiable baseline. Licensed operators must segregate player funds, undergo regular audits, and offer access to dispute resolution through the Independent Betting Adjudication Service. Always verify the licence number on the operator’s site and cross-check it on the UKGC register before depositing.

What happens if an independent casino refuses to pay my winnings?
First, contact the operator’s support team and document everything — screenshots of your balance, your bet history, and any correspondence. If they still refuse, escalate to the Independent Betting Adjudication Service, which mediates disputes between players and licensed operators. As a last resort, the UK Gambling Commission itself can investigate a licensed operator’s conduct. Refusals are rare among licensed sites, but the safety net exists for a reason.
